  • You can also opt to hide your name and contact information by selecting ‘Yes’ to Hide My Name and Contact Info at the top of the Profile page. This will also hide your CV.
  • When creating, building and updating your physician profile, your account settings determine who can access and view your profile.
  • If you chose a private profile, your name will not be accessed by employers who conduct physician and profile searches, as they will see only your user id. However, you can still respond to their job postings.
  • If you have applied for a job through a PhysicianCareer.com’s posting, your contact information will then be visible to the employer so that they can contact you directly.
  • If you do not choose to hide your profile name and contact info, employers will be able to see your full name and contact info and match you to their practice opportunity.
